Is Bis-(HEA Polycaprolactone) PEG-2/PPG-3/IPDI Copolymer vegan?

Bis-(HEA Polycaprolactone) PEG-2/PPG-3/IPDI Copolymer

Vegan Vegan
Vegetarian Vegetarian

This synthetic copolymer is formed from PEG-2, PPG-3 and isophorone diisocyanate (IPDI), end-capped with hydroxyethylacrylate polycaprolactone, used as a film-forming polymer in cosmetics.
